PRODUCT FAMILY OVERVIEW
This datasheet contains the specifications for the two branches of products in the SmartVoltage 4-Mbit boot block flash memory family: the -BE/CE suffix products feature a low VCCoperating range of 2.7V–3.6V; the -BV/CV suffix products offer 3.0V–3.6V operation. Both BE/CE and BV/CV products also operate at 5V for high-speed access times. Throughout this datasheet, the 28F400 refers to all x8/x16 4-Mbit products, while 28F004B refers to all x8 4-Mbit boot block products. Also, the term “2.7V” generally refers to the full voltage range 2.7V–3.6V.

Intel SmartVoltage Technology
5V or 12V Program/Erase
2.7V, 3.3V or 5V Read Operation
Increased Programming Throughput at 12V VPP
Very High-Performance Read
5V: 60/80/120 ns Max. Access Time, 30/40 ns Max. Output Enable Time
3V: 110/150/180 ns Max Access 65/90 ns Max. Output Enable Time
2.7V: 120 ns Max Access 65 ns Max. Output Enable Time
Low Power Consumption
Max 60 mA Read Current at 5V
Max 30 mA Read Current at 2.7V–3.6V
x8/x16-Selectable Input/Output Bus
28F400 for High Performance 16- or 32-bit CPUs
x8-Only Input/Output Architecture
28F004B for Space-Constrained 8-bit Applications
Optimized Array Blocking Architecture
One 16-KB Protected Boot Block
Two 8-KB Parameter Blocks
One 96-KB Main Block
Three 128-KB Main Blocks
Top or Bottom Boot Locations
Absolute Hardware-Protection for Boot Block
Software EEPROM Emulation with Parameter Blocks
Extended Temperature Operation
–40°C to +85°C
Extended Cycling Capability
100,000 Block Erase Cycles (Commercial Temperature)
10,000 Block Erase Cycles (Extended Temperature)
Automated Word/Byte Program and Block Erase
Industry-Standard Command User Interface
Status Registers
Erase Suspend Capability
SRAM-Compatible Write Interface
Automatic Power Savings Feature
1 mA Typical ICCActive Current in Static Operation
Reset/Deep Power-Down Input
0.2 µA ICCTypical
Provides Reset for Boot Operations
Hardware Data Protection Feature
Write Lockout during Power Transitions
Industry-Standard Surface Mount Packaging
40-Lead TSOP
44-Lead PSOP: JEDEC ROM Compatible
48-Lead TSOP
56-Lead TSOP
Footprint Upgradeable from 2-Mbit and to 8-Mbit Boot Block Flash Memories
ETOX™ IV Flash Technology
